王朝网络
分享
 
 
 

Oracle数据库基础教程

王朝导购·作者佚名
 
Oracle数据库基础教程  点此进入淘宝搜索页搜索
  特别声明:本站仅为商品信息简介,并不出售商品,您可点击文中链接进入淘宝网搜索页搜索该商品,有任何问题请与具体淘宝商家联系。
  参考价格: 点此进入淘宝搜索页搜索
  分类: 图书,计算机/网络,数据库,Oracle,

作者: 王瑛等编著

出 版 社: 人民邮电出版社

出版时间: 2008-10-1字数: 543000版次: 1页数: 322印刷时间: 2008/10/01开本: 16开印次: 1纸张: 胶版纸I S B N : 9787115180438包装: 平装编辑推荐

体现作者多年的数据库管理与开发经验,结合大量实用技巧,重点突出,便于灵活掌握,提供典型应用实例与上机实验,分析详细,实用性强。

本书是作者结合多年的Oracle数据库管理与开发经验编写而成,比较详尽地介绍了管理和开发Oracle数据库应用程序所必备的相关技术。本书首先从基本的数据库管理出发,全面介绍Oracle 10g数据库存储、安全、维护等必备管理技术,使读者熟悉Oracle 10g数据库,从而为进一步阅读奠定基础。然后,通过大量小例子,介绍Oracle 10g数据库开发技术,使读者能够在实践中逐步掌握较复杂和较抽象的知识点。最后,结合实际应用,讲解了两个数据库实例的开发过程,即使用Visual Basic开发C/S构架的Oracle数据库应用系统和使用ASP开发B/S构架的Oracle数据库应用系统。此外。本书每章都配有相应的习题和比较实用的实验,帮助读者理解所学习的内容,使读者对于Oracle 10g的基础知识、应用能力和创新意识得到全面培养与提高。

本书在内容的选择、深度的把握上充分考虑初学者的特点,内容安排上力求做到循序渐进。本书不仅适合本科教学,也适合Oracle的各类培训班和准备使用Oracle开发数据库应用程序的读者参考。

内容简介

Oracle 10g是目前最流行的数据库开发平台之一,拥有较高的市场占有率和众多的高端用户,成为大型数据库应用系统的首选后台数据库系统。Oracle数据库管理和应用系统开发已经成为国内外高校计算机专业和许多非计算机专业的必修或选修课程。

本书结合大量的实例,介绍如何利用Oracle 10g来管理和维护数据,以及使用Visual Basic和ASP等开发工具开发C/S(Client/Server)模式和B/S(Browser/Server)模式网络数据库应用程序。

本书可作为大学本科相关课程教材,也可供广大Oracle数据库管理员和数据库应用程序开发人员参考。

目录

第1章Oracle 10g简介

1.1Oracle 10g产品概述

1.2Oracle 10g数据库系统的体系结构

1.2.1Oracle 10g体系结构概述

1.2.2网格结构

1.2.3数据库逻辑结构

1.2.4数据库物理结构

1.2.5数据库例程

1.2.6内部存储结构

1.2.7进程结构

1.2.8应用程序结构

1.2.9事务

习题

第2章安装和卸载Oracle 10g数据库

2.1安装前准备

2.1.1安装Oracle 10g数据库的硬件需求

2.1.2安装Oracle 10g数据库的软件需求

2.2Oracle 10g数据库安装过程

2.2.1服务器安装过程

2.2.2客户端安装过程

2.2.3设置环境变量

2.2.4常用Oracle服务

2.3完全卸载Oracle 10g

习题

第3章Oracle数据库管理工具

3.1企业管理器

3.1.1Enterprise Manager 10g

3.1.2Oracle Enterprise Manager

3.2Oracle Administration Assistant

3.2.1启动Oracle Administration Assistant

3.2.2设置默认实例和注册表变量

3.2.3设置操作系统数据库管理员和操作员

3.2.4Oracle数据库管理

3.3网络配置工具

3.3.1Oracle Net简介

3.3.2Net Manager

3.3.3Net Configuration Assistant

3.4SQL*Plus和iSQL*Plus

3.4.1使用SQL*Plus

3.4.2使用iSQL*Plus

习题

第4章数据库管理、配置和维护

4.1关闭和启动数据库

4.1.1Oracle数据库实例的状态

4.1.2关闭数据库实例

4.1.3启动数据库实例

4.1.4改变数据库的状态

4.2创建和删除数据库

4.2.1创建数据库

4.2.2删除数据库

4.3配置数据库

4.3.1查看和设置内存参数

4.3.2还原管理

4.3.3初始化参数管理

4.4用户管理

4.4.1Oracle数据库用户类型

4.4.2默认数据库管理员用户

4.4.3数据库管理员(DBA)的权限

习题

第5章数据库存储管理

5.1表空间管理

5.1.1查看表空间信息

5.1.2创建表空间

5.1.3设置和修改表空间属性

5.1.4删除表空间

5.1.5段和数据块管理

5.1.6撤销表空间

5.2控制文件管理

5.2.1创建控制文件

5.2.2恢复控制文件

5.2.3删除控制文件

5.2.4查看控制文件信息

5.3重做日志管理

5.3.1重做日志的基本概念

5.3.2查看重做日志信息

5.3.3创建重做日志组和成员

5.3.4重命名重做日志成员

5.3.5删除重做日志组和成员

5.3.6清空重做日志文件

5.4归档日志管理

5.4.1归档日志文件和归档模式

5.4.2管理归档模式

5.4.3指定归档目的地

5.4.4查看归档日志信息

习题

第6章数据库安全管理

6.1Oracle认证方法

6.1.1操作系统身份认证

6.1.2网络身份认证

6.1.3Oracle数据库身份认证

6.1.4数据库管理员认证

6.2用户管理

6.2.1创建用户

6.2.2修改用户

6.2.3权限管理语句

6.2.4删除用户

6.3角色管理

6.3.1Oracle系统角色

6.3.2创建角色

6.3.3对角色授权

6.3.4指定用户的角色

6.3.5修改角色

6.3.6删除角色

习题

第7章数据库对象管理

7.1表管理

7.1.1创建表

7.1.2修改表

7.1.3删除表

7.1.4插入数据

7.1.5修改数据

7.1.6删除数据

7.2数据查询

7.2.1SELECT语句的基本应用

7.2.2定义显示标题

7.2.3设置查询条件

7.2.4对查询结果排序

7.2.5使用统计函数

7.2.6连接查询

7.3视图管理

7.3.1视图的基本概念

7.3.2视图管理页面

7.3.3创建视图

7.3.4修改视图

7.3.5删除视图

7.4索引管理

7.4.1索引的概念

7.4.2索引管理页面

7.4.3创建索引

7.4.4修改索引

7.4.5删除索引

7.5序列管理

7.5.1创建序列

7.5.2修改序列

7.5.3删除序列

7.5.4序列的使用

习题

第8章备份和恢复

8.1使用EM进行备份和恢复

8.1.1使用EM备份数据库

8.1.2使用EM恢复数据库

8.2RMAN技术

8.2.1基本概念

8.2.2将数据库设置为归档日志模式

8.2.3创建恢复目录所使用的表空间

8.2.4创建RMAN用户并授权

8.2.5创建恢复目录

8.2.6注册目标数据库

8.2.7RMAN备份和恢复

8.3闪回(Flashback)技术

8.3.1闪回技术概述

8.3.2闪回数据库

8.3.3闪回表

8.3.4闪回回收站

8.3.5闪回查询(Flashback Query)

8.3.6闪回版本查询

8.3.7闪回事务查询

习题

第9章PL/SQL语言基础

9.1PL/SQL简介

9.1.1PL/SQL语言的结构

9.1.2PL/SQL示例程序

9.2PL/SQL组件

9.2.1声明部分

9.2.2执行部分

9.2.3异常处理部分

9.3常用函数

9.3.1数值型函数

9.3.2字符型函数

9.3.3日期型函数

9.3.4统计函数

习题

第10章游标、存储过程和触发器

10.1游标

10.1.1游标的基本概念

10.1.2游标控制语句

10.1.3游标属性

10.1.4游标FOR循环

10.2存储过程管理

10.2.1过程

10.2.2函数

10.2.3程序包

10.3触发器管理

10.3.1触发器的基本概念

10.3.2创建及使用触发器

习题

第11章ADO数据访问技术

11.1ADO数据模型

11.2数据库访问控件

11.2.1ADO Data控件

11.2.2DataList控件和DataCombo控件

11.2.3DataGrid控件

11.3常用ADO对象

11.3.1Connection对象

11.3.2Command对象

11.3.3Recordset对象

11.3.4Field对象

习题

第12章图书借阅管理系统

12.1系统总体设计

12.1.1系统功能描述

12.1.2创建数据库用户

12.1.3数据库表结构设计

12.2设计工程框架

12.2.1创建工程

12.2.2添加模块

12.2.3添加类模块

12.3系统主界面和登录模块设计

12.3.1设计主界面

12.3.2登录模块设计

12.4图书分类管理模块设计

12.4.1使用TreeView控件管理图书分类的方法

12.4.2设计图书分类信息编辑窗体

12.4.3设计图书分类信息管理窗体

12.4.4设计图书分类选择窗体

12.5图书信息管理模块设计

12.5.1设计图书信息编辑窗体

12.5.2设计图书信息管理窗体

12.5.3设计图书选择窗体

12.6图书库存管理模块设计

12.6.1设计图书库存编辑模块

12.6.2设计图书库存管理模块

12.6.3设计库存盘点编辑模块

12.6.4设计库存盘点管理模块

12.7借阅证件管理模块设计

12.7.1设计借阅证信息编辑窗体

12.7.2设计借阅证信息管理窗体

12.7.3设计图书借阅记录窗体

12.8图书借阅管理模块设计

12.8.1设计图书借阅信息编辑窗体

12.8.2设计图书借阅信息管理窗体

12.8.3设计图书催还信息管理窗体

习题

附录1实验

实验1数据库管理

目的和要求

实验准备

实验内容

1.使用SHUTDOWN命令关闭数据库实例

2.使用STARTUP命令启动数据库实例

3.使用Oracle Enterprise Manager关闭数据库实例

4.使用Oracle Enterprise Manager启动数据库实例

5.使用SQL语句创建数据库

6.使用SQL语句删除数据库

实验2角色和用户管理

目的和要求

实验准备

实验内容

1.使用SQL语句创建数据库角色

2.使用SQL语句为数据库角色授权

3.使用SQL语句创建数据库用户

4.使用SQL语句指定用户角色

实验3表和视图管理

目的和要求

实验准备

实验内容

1.使用SQL语句创建表

2.使用SQL语句向表中插入数据

3.练习使用SQL语句修改表中的数据

4.练习使用SQL语句删除表中的数据

5.练习使用SELECT语句查询数据

6.练习使用SQL语句创建视图

实验4管理索引和序列

目的和要求

实验准备

实验内容

1.使用SQL语句创建索引

2.在创建表的同时创建索引

3.使用SQL语句创建序列

4.在插入数据时使用序列

实验5PL/SQL编程

目的和要求

实验准备

实验内容

1.使用条件语句

2.使用分支语句

3.使用循环语句

4.使用系统函数

实验6使用游标、存储过程和触发器

目的和要求

实验准备

实验内容

1.创建和使用游标

2.编写和执行自定义过程

3.编写和执行自定义函数

4.创建和使用触发器

大作业1:VB+Oracle学生档案管理系统

项目1数据库结构设计

项目2设计工程框架

项目3系统主界面和登录模块设计

项目4院系管理模块设计

项目5学生信息管理模块设计

项目6学生奖惩管理模块设计

项目7学籍变动管理模块设计

项目8用户管理模块设计

大作业2:ASP+Oracle网上购物系统

项目1数据库结构设计

项目2目录结构与通用模块

项目3管理主界面与登录程序设计

项目4公告信息管理模块设计

项目5商品类别管理模块设计

项目6商品管理模块设计

项目7订单管理模块设计

项目8系统主界面与登录程序设计

项目9设计商品查询及购买模块

附录2下载Oracle 10g

附录3Oracle 10g系统权限

参考文献

书摘插图

第1章Oracle 10g简介

Oracle 10g是当前最流行的大型关系数据库之一,支持包括32位Windows、64位Windows、OS、HP-UX、AIX5L、Solaris和Linux等多种操作系统,拥有广泛的用户和大量的应用案例。本章介绍Oracle 10g数据库的版本信息,产品组成以及体系结构等,为管理Oracle 10g奠定基础。

……

 
 
免责声明:本文为网络用户发布,其观点仅代表作者个人观点,与本站无关,本站仅提供信息存储服务。文中陈述内容未经本站证实,其真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
2023年上半年GDP全球前十五强
 百态   2023-10-24
美众议院议长启动对拜登的弹劾调查
 百态   2023-09-13
上海、济南、武汉等多地出现不明坠落物
 探索   2023-09-06
印度或要将国名改为“巴拉特”
 百态   2023-09-06
男子为女友送行,买票不登机被捕
 百态   2023-08-20
手机地震预警功能怎么开?
 干货   2023-08-06
女子4年卖2套房花700多万做美容:不但没变美脸,面部还出现变形
 百态   2023-08-04
住户一楼被水淹 还冲来8头猪
 百态   2023-07-31
女子体内爬出大量瓜子状活虫
 百态   2023-07-25
地球连续35年收到神秘规律性信号,网友:不要回答!
 探索   2023-07-21
全球镓价格本周大涨27%
 探索   2023-07-09
钱都流向了那些不缺钱的人,苦都留给了能吃苦的人
 探索   2023-07-02
倩女手游刀客魅者强控制(强混乱强眩晕强睡眠)和对应控制抗性的关系
 百态   2020-08-20
美国5月9日最新疫情:美国确诊人数突破131万
 百态   2020-05-09
荷兰政府宣布将集体辞职
 干货   2020-04-30
倩女幽魂手游师徒任务情义春秋猜成语答案逍遥观:鹏程万里
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案神机营:射石饮羽
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案昆仑山:拔刀相助
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案天工阁:鬼斧神工
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案丝路古道:单枪匹马
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:与虎谋皮
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:李代桃僵
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案镇郊荒野:指鹿为马
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案金陵:小鸟依人
 干货   2019-11-12
倩女幽魂手游师徒任务情义春秋猜成语答案金陵:千金买邻
 干货   2019-11-12
 
>>返回首页<<
推荐阅读
 
 
频道精选
 
更多商品
Pro/ENGINEER Wildfire 4模具设计实例图解(配光盘)(CAD/CAM实例图解视频教程)
Pro/ENGINEER Wildfire 4.0中文版工业设计手册
PHP 完全自学手册(附光盘)
Photoshop平面设计 (21世纪高职高专规划教材)
Photoshop CS3色彩修正与调整高级技法
OL一族健康操
Nikon D40/D40X尼康数码单反摄影手册
Net Micro Framework嵌入式开发入门与典型实例
MSC.ADAMS 技术与工程分析实例 (万水CAE技术丛书)
MasterCAM X2模具加工实例图解(配光盘)(CAD/CAM实例图解视频教程)
静静地坐在废墟上,四周的荒凉一望无际,忽然觉得,凄凉也很美
© 2005- 王朝网络 版权所有